The Episcopal Church in Vermont – Diocesan Council (Official Web Page)

The Diocesan Council is the legislative arm of the Diocese between conventions and consists of the Bishop as Chair, ex officio; the Chancellor, ex officio; and three members elected by each of the five Mission Districts. The Canon to the Ordinary and the Diocesan Treasurer have a seat and voice, but no vote.

Mission Statement of Diocesan Council:

The Diocesan Council exists to support and extend the work of the Bishop and Convention, to promote the health and well-being of the Diocese, and to lead and support the people of the Diocese in our mission to pray the prayer of Christ, learn the mind of Christ, and do the deeds of Christ.

To implement this mission, Council will:

  1. monitor and oversee the implementation of the Diocesan Priorities
  2. work to improve the quality of life of all people in Vermont and beyond.
  3. assist local congregations to hold up their faith and to be held up by it.
  4. create opportunities for people to celebrate, share and learn about their faith, and to experience a new life within it.
  5. participate with the Bishop and local congregations in recognizing the gifts of challenge and change, and support them in engaging with these gifts.
  6. strive to become an agent of God’s reconciling love in the world.
  7. be faithful stewards of the financial and administrative resources of the Diocese, including the preparation and monitoring of the Diocesan budget.

Budget and Finance Committee

The Budget and Finance Committee of the Diocesan Council is composed of some members of Diocesan Council, plus the Bishop, the Canon to the Ordinary, and other appointed members. The members are:

  • Gerry Davis, Treasurer
  • The Rt. Rev. Tom Ely, Bishop Ex-officio
  • Lynn Bates, Canon to the Ordinary
  • The Rev. Dave Ganter, Assistant Treasurer
  • Rich Sagui, Financial Administrator
